Dick and Jane in the 1950s, continued

The 1956 edition of the Dick and Jane reader, The New Our Friends, opens with Dick and Jane wondering who will live in the new house next door. Puzzled by the toy horse, which they associate with boys, and the dolls, which they associate with girls, being moved in, they experience a big surprise upon meeting the apparently male twins.
